Homes and businesses in Cowes are without power this afternoon (Saturday) – and it is expected to be several hours before supplies are restored.
It was just gone midday that over 850 properties in the PO31 region lost electricity, owing to a underground network fault.
A total of 58 properties have been hit by the outage, which is not expected to be resolved until 17:00 this afternoon.
Aldi supermarket has shut up shop as a result. Other firms are also affected.
Scottish and Southern Electricity Networks are aware of the issue and an engineer is now on site.
For further information about this power cut call the dedicated helpline by dialling 105.
